The Evolution of Corrugated Sheet Manufacturing Machines
Corrugated sheets have become an essential component in various industries, providing strength, durability, and lightweight properties that are ideal for packaging, construction, and even automotive applications. The manufacturing of corrugated sheets has evolved significantly over the years, driven by advances in technology and a growing demand for efficient production processes.
At the heart of this evolution are the corrugated sheet manufacturing machines. These machines are designed to produce corrugated sheets from raw materials, typically paper, by using a series of industrial processes. The primary steps include the production of the corrugated medium, or the wavy paper layer, and the flat liners that form the outer surfaces of the sheets.
Modern corrugated sheet manufacturing machines are equipped with advanced features that enhance their efficiency and output quality. Most machines today utilize a combination of rotary die-cutting and flexographic printing technologies, allowing for high-speed production and customization options. This integration not only streamlines the manufacturing process but also enables manufacturers to create printed sheets with intricate designs and branding, catering to specific customer needs.
One of the key advancements in the production of corrugated sheets is the introduction of Automation and Industry 4.0 technologies. Intelligent sensors and software systems are now implemented to monitor production lines in real-time. This technology provides valuable data insights, allowing manufacturers to optimize machine performance, reduce waste, and improve the overall quality of the corrugated sheets produced. By automating several aspects of the manufacturing process, businesses can also minimize labor costs and reduce the risk of human error.
Sustainability has become a critical focus in the manufacturing industry, and the production of corrugated sheets is no exception. Modern corrugated sheet manufacturing machines are designed with eco-friendly processes in mind. Many machines now incorporate waste recycling systems that allow manufacturers to reuse paper scraps, significantly reducing raw material consumption and lowering environmental impact. Additionally, leveraging biodegradable materials in production is becoming more popular, aligning with the growing consumer demand for sustainable products.
Moreover, manufacturers are investing in high-speed machines that can produce larger sheets without sacrificing quality. This capability significantly enhances productivity and meets the rising demand within various sectors. These machines also often include features for quick changeovers, allowing businesses to switch between production lines with minimal downtime, thus maximizing efficiency.
